Eliezer Garcia-Guzman, Northeast's leading hitter, solidified his role on Thursday. Garcia-Guzman was unstoppable, going 2-for-3 with three runs, four RBI, and one triple. He is becoming a predictor of Northeast's success: when he posts at least two runs the team is undefeated (and 0-6 when he doesn't).
Garcia-Guzman and Northeast are on the road again on Friday to play Central at 3:15 p.m. The Vikings will be headed into this one with a sizable disadvantage in the rankings (they're ranked 328 places lower in Pennsylvania), but they're not letting that get them down.
